Taxation for those leaving France

You are liable for tax on everything you earned in France prior to your departure as well as on any French earnings that are taxable in France under international tax treaties that you earned after your departure.

If you live outside France, always check with the local tax authority to find out if you have filing and/or payment obligations in your country of residence, even if you pay taxes in France.

If you own property in France, you are liable for property tax and residence tax.

If a rental property is in your name as of 1 January of the year you leave France, you are liable for the residence tax.
